Transaction 3091a31cbadd8c2be9103db931aa9d363b5ff2a952a9313d591ea68cf5fa23e4

3 Input
2 Outputs
  • 3091a31cbadd8c2be9103db931aa9d363b5ff2a952a9313d591ea68cf5fa23e4:0
  • value  2073388
    address  1LfhuJULxYYpomaKyHt5DGxZShr3eBkXPM
  • 3091a31cbadd8c2be9103db931aa9d363b5ff2a952a9313d591ea68cf5fa23e4:1
  • value  318638
    address  bc1qf4qtdm2x5ufug0krl0emm4c3w883rqhnevqc93